Parents/guardians of students residing in Forsyth County may request an Out-of-District waiver for the following reasons:
- Change of Address within Forsyth County
- Current Resident Moving within Forsyth County
- Sibling School
- Sibling in Special Education
- Employee's Child
- Program Need (during window only)
Parents/guardians of Out-of-District students must provide their own transportation, except for students who are accepted for an Out-of-District to attend Alliance Academy for Innovation. FCS will provide transportation for students approved to attend Alliance Academy for Innovation.
Families with a change of residence must complete a Change of Address Form and must supply current proof of residency. The Out-of-District deadline does not apply to families who move within the county.
Schools projected to be at or over capacity for 2026-2027 are not able to approve Out-of-District requests for new students. Schools that have been redistricted to relieve overcrowding will not accept Out-of-District students for three years from the start of the school year when new attendance lines were established, except for specific high school program needs.
